John 17:6-19 - Jesus Prays For His Disciples

6 I have made thy Name known to the men whom thou hast given to me from the world (thine they were, and thou gavest them to me), and they have held to thy word. 7 They know now that whatever thou hast given me comes from thee, 8 for I have given them the words thou gavest me, and they have received them; they are now sure that I came from thee and believe that thou didst send me. 9 I pray for them ??not for the world but for those whom thou hast given me do I pray; for they are thine 10 (all mine is thine and thine is mine), and I am glorified in them. 11 I am to be in the world no longer, but they are to be in the world; I come to thee. Holy Father, keep them by the power of thy Name which thou hast given me, that they may be one as we are one. 12 When I was with them, I kept them by the power of thy Name which thou hast given me; I guarded them, and not one of them perished ??only the son of perdition, that the scripture might be fulfilled. 13 But now I come to thee (I speak thus in the world that they may have my joy complete within them). 14 I have given them thy word, and the world has hated them because they do not belong to the world any more than I belong to the world. 15 I pray not that thou wilt take them out of the world, but that thou wilt keep them from the evil one. 16 They do not belong to the world any more than I belong to the world. 17 Consecrate them by thy truth: thy word is truth. 18 As thou hast sent me into the world, so have I sent them into the world, 19 and for their sake I consecrate myself that they may be consecrated by the truth.
